Sangregado
Sangregado is a hamlet in Guanacaste, Costa Rica. Sangregado is situated nearby to the neighborhood Bajo Tabacón, as well as near the hamlet Santa Eulalia.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Presa Sangregado Dam
Dam
Presa Sangregado Dam is a high-earthen hydroelectric dam on the north-east shore of Lake Arenal in the Alajuela Province of northwest Costa Rica. The dam is 288 feet and 184 feet high. Presa Sangregado Dam is situated 3½ km south of Sangregado.
